What is a minimalist bed?

A minimalist bed is a simple, functional bed designed with clean lines and minimal decoration, focusing on essential elements to create a clutter-free and serene sleeping environment. These beds often feature a low profile and use natural materials, aligning with the minimalist philosophy of simplicity and understated elegance.

What Are the Key Features of a Minimalist Bed?

Minimalist beds are characterized by several distinct features that set them apart from more traditional styles. Understanding these features can help you determine if a minimalist bed is right for your bedroom.

  • Simplicity: Minimalist beds often have a straightforward design, avoiding ornate details or excessive embellishments.
  • Clean Lines: The design typically incorporates straight lines and geometric shapes, contributing to a modern aesthetic.
  • Low Profile: Many minimalist beds have a low height, which can create a sense of openness in a room.
  • Natural Materials: Wood, metal, and other natural materials are commonly used, emphasizing sustainability and quality.
  • Neutral Colors: The color palette often includes whites, grays, and natural wood tones, promoting a calm and restful atmosphere.

Why Choose a Minimalist Bed?

Choosing a minimalist bed can offer several advantages, making it a popular choice for those looking to simplify their living spaces.

  • Space Efficiency: Minimalist beds are designed to maximize space, making them ideal for smaller bedrooms or studio apartments.
  • Versatility: The neutral design and color scheme allow these beds to complement various interior styles, from modern to Scandinavian.
  • Focus on Quality: By prioritizing essential elements, minimalist beds often emphasize high-quality craftsmanship and durable materials.
  • Promotes Relaxation: The uncluttered design can contribute to a more peaceful and relaxing sleep environment.

How to Style a Minimalist Bedroom

Creating a minimalist bedroom involves more than just selecting the right bed. Here are some tips to achieve a cohesive minimalist look:

  1. Declutter Regularly: Keep surfaces clear and only display essential items.
  2. Choose Functional Furniture: Opt for pieces that serve multiple purposes, such as a bed with built-in storage.
  3. Use a Neutral Color Palette: Stick to whites, grays, and earth tones to maintain a serene atmosphere.
  4. Incorporate Textures: Add interest with different textures, like a woven rug or linen bedding.
  5. Emphasize Natural Light: Use sheer curtains or blinds to maximize natural light in the room.

What Are the Benefits of a Platform Bed?

A platform bed offers several benefits, including durability and support. It eliminates the need for a box spring, providing a sturdy base for your mattress. This design can also enhance the aesthetic appeal of a minimalist bedroom, thanks to its sleek and modern look.

How Do I Maintain a Minimalist Bed?

Maintaining a minimalist bed involves regular cleaning and decluttering. Dust the frame and vacuum under the bed to prevent dirt buildup. Rotate or flip the mattress periodically to ensure even wear. Keep bedding simple and replace worn items as needed.

Can a Minimalist Bed Be Comfortable?

Yes, a minimalist bed can be comfortable. Comfort largely depends on the mattress and bedding you choose. Opt for a high-quality mattress and soft, breathable linens to enhance your sleeping experience. The minimalist design itself does not compromise comfort.

Are Minimalist Beds Expensive?

Minimalist beds can vary in price, but they are often affordable due to their simple design. Prices range from budget-friendly options to more luxurious models, depending on materials and craftsmanship. Investing in a quality minimalist bed can provide long-term value.

What Mattress Works Best with a Minimalist Bed?

A memory foam or latex mattress pairs well with a minimalist bed, offering support and comfort. These mattresses conform to the body’s shape, providing pressure relief and a good night’s sleep. Choose a mattress that suits your personal preferences and sleeping style.
